Administrator

We are looking for an experienced Administrator to coordinate the clergy appointment process, process DBS checks for new and continuing clergy and provide support for clergy HR processes.

This is a hybrid-working role with onsite working in Hove or Chichester.

Position: Administrator

Salary: Starting salary for this post will be £24,837 per annum

Location: Hybrid (either Hove or Chichester - with a requirement to work at least one day each week at the other site, precise working pattern to be agreed, with the option to work remotely for part of the week).

Hours: Full-time, 35 per week hours per week

Contract: Permanent

Closing Date: midnight on 7th September 2025

About the Role

You will manage clergy appointments and provide HR administration support, which includes:

  • Liaising with suffragan bishops, archdeacons and PAs on clergy appointment adverts, applications, and interviews.
  • Managing the Pathways portal, forwarding application packs and maintaining records.
  • Coordinating shortlisting, Right to Work checks and safer recruitment compliance.
  • Distributing applications to bishops, archdeacons and parish representatives, ensuring timely, accurate communication throughout the recruitment process.
  • Preparing and manage clergy statements, property licences, and departure notices.
  • Maintaining and update personal files, vacancy progress records, and distribution lists.
  • Liaising with other dioceses on clergy movements, ensure role descriptions are current, and notify relevant officers and publications of appointments, departures, and retirements in line with policy.

About You

With a good general standard of education, you will have experience of complex administrative processes and HR-relevant office experience.

You will also have:

  • Excellent communication skills both oral and in writing
  • Strong interpersonal skills and effective at building good working relationships with a wide range of people
  • Good organisational skills, with the ability to prioritise and manage a varied workload
  • A good working knowledge of MS Office applications such as SharePoint, Teams, Word and Excel
  • The ability to work confidently on own initiative, and capable at collaboration and teamwork
  • An understanding, or ability rapidly to acquire knowledge, of the Church of England and its systems, structures and terminology
  • Sympathy with the aims and mission of the Church of England and the work and ministry of the Bishop of Chichester

The organisation wants its commitment to equality, diversity, and inclusion for all to be reflected in the composition of staff and are particularly keen to receive applications from candidates from communities currently underrepresented in the diocese.

In return:

  • Flexitime and remote working options
  • 25 days annual leave plus bank holidays
  • Membership of the Church Administrators Pension Builder scheme
